Posted Tuesday at 01:58 PM 5 hours ago, Charu said: Just to confirm, the LAST BSA affects the Cantor color, correct? So if you incubate a Cantor, then influence it, in theory it should be pink, right? You are right that the last BSA used affects the color, but influence is not one of the BSAs that has an effect. Teleport = orange Precog = blue Incubate = red The only way to get a pink one is to use NONE OF THOSE because once you change the color with one of those there is no way to go back to pink.
